The 4 Disciplines of Execution: Achieving Your Wildly Important Goals
Chris McChesney, Sean Covey, and Jim Huling
Free Press, 2012, 352 pages
Summary
This book presents a solution to the lack of organizational goal fulfillment. The authors suggest that many organizations and teams face the “whirlwind” (the daily and ongoing tasks everybody must fulfill) and never get to their most important goals. They then construct a framework for focusing on a few very important goals, identifying lead measures, scoring progress and creating an ongoing “cadence of accountability” (these are the 4 disciplines or “4DX”).
